Enhancement of the Curie Temperature and the Remanence in NdFeB/Fe Multilayer Films
Ta Van Khoa,Chong-Oh Kim,Luu Tuan Tai,Than Duc Hien,Nguyen Phuc Duong 한국물리학회 2008 THE JOURNAL OF THE KOREAN PHYSICAL SOCIETY Vol.52 No.5
Multilayer films of Si/Mo(20 nm)/[NdFeB(35 nm)/ Fe(dFe)]4/Mo(30 nm) (dFe: thickness of Fe layer = 0, 5, 10, 15 nm) were prepared by RF sputtering at room temperature. The effect of the thickness of the Fe buffer layers on the Curie temperature and the remanence magnetization of the films have been studied. The Curie temperature and remanence magnetization of the films increased from 315℃ to 335℃and from 0.75 kG to 0.82 kG, respectively, when dFe was increased from 0 to 10 nm. However, the Curie temperature and the remanence decreased to 327℃ and 0.72 kG, respectively, when dFe reached 15 nm.
